Baseball overcome by Randolph-Macon in double header

SALEM, Va. - The Roanoke College baseball team couldn't find a way to best the RV Randolph-Macon Yellow Jackets in their weekend ODAC doubleheader. 
 
Game 1 Information 
RV Randolph-Macon 6, Roanoke 3 
Records: Randolph-Macon (7-5, 3-2), Roanoke (8-8-1, 1-1-1) 
Location: Salem, Va. (Salem Memorial Ballpark) 

Game 1 Notes and Notables 

  • Roanoke scored first before RMC took a 3-2 lead in the seventh. The Maroons then tied it up in the ninth on a Danny Ferguson pinch hit single before ultimately falling in the 11th inning.  

  • Thomas Burgess tossed his longest outing of the season so far, pitching 6.2 innings in his start. His allowed just one earned run on six hits and a walk while striking out three. 

  • Liam Murphy was the only Maroon to register multiple hits with two. 

  • Hunter von Zelowitz made his first appearance of the season, pinch hitting in the ninth and staying in at second base for the rest of the game. 

Game 2 Information 
RV Randolph-Macon 19, Roanoke 7 
Records: Randolph-Macon (8-5, 4-2), Roanoke (8-9-1, 1-2-1) 
Location: Salem, Va. (Salem Memorial Ballpark) 

Game 2 Notes and Notables 

  • The sides went punch for punch through the first five innings, but RMC finally got to Roanoke and RC couldn't find a response. 

  • Ferguson had a few firsts in the game, tallying his first career stolen base and first career triple. He actually tallied two triples and scored three runs for this third multi-run game in just six games. 

  • Jack Fehlner had a multi-RBI game after driving in a pair with a double down the left field line in the fifth.
